A P/E of 32.28 paired with EPS of 5.69 suggests the market is pricing in strong earnings power and continued growth, but not at the extreme multiples seen at prior AI peaks. Profitability remains robust, and the valuation is elevated yet still within a reasonable range for a dominant, high‑growth semiconductor and AI infrastructure leader. Overall, the financial profile points to a fundamentally strong, highly profitable company with durable earnings momentum.
The stock is trading at €183.70, about 12.5% above its 200-day moving average of €163.39, indicating an ongoing longer-term uptrend despite a recent 2.9% pullback over the last month. An RSI of 44.16 suggests the stock is neither overbought nor oversold, reflecting a period of consolidation rather than extreme sentiment. Technically, the setup appears balanced: the trend is still positive, but near-term momentum has cooled.
Alternative data for NVIDIA shows strong and broad digital engagement, with very high web traffic and substantial daily app downloads, consistent with a large and active user and developer ecosystem. Social media followings across major platforms are sizable and still growing, suggesting brand strength and sustained interest in NVIDIA’s products and AI leadership. Job openings are stable at a high absolute level, indicating ongoing investment in talent without signs of abrupt expansion or contraction.
Combining strong earnings power and a still-growth-oriented valuation with a positive long-term price trend and robust alternative data signals yields an overall bullish stance on NVIDIA. While the stock has recently pulled back and momentum indicators are neutral, the company’s financial strength, strategic AI positioning, and broad digital engagement support a constructive medium- to long-term outlook. Investors should remain aware that valuation is not cheap, but current data do not indicate a fundamental deterioration.
